We all know of the Holocaust, the terrible atrocities committed by the Nazis against Jews, various ethnic groups, homosexuals, political prisoners and other groups not of their liking.
We know about it, but there's a vast difference between having taken in information and actually realizing the gravity of it.
I've been websearching the Holocaust and two things particularly moved me. One is an eyewitness account of a Holocaust surviver who spent a year of his life in the death camp Treblinka. Its a 40 page document I've attached to this post. Definitely worth the read, for those interested in what it was like, for one man who has been there.
The other thing is a 49 minute film shot by the Allies in 1945 that documents the extent of the atrocities they found when they liberated the concentration camps, and which served as evidence in the Nuremberg Trials. The 6 reels of the original evidence film is chopped up into 7 parts on youtube, and I attached them below. It is without a doubt the most graphic and shocking footage I have ever seen.
I have attached it below.
WARNING: both the .pdf and the film footage is extremely graphic, for most it will be uncomfortable to watch. I think however that for a better understanding, for those who seek it, it is good to be informed, even if it is unpleasant.
